Portable c++ compiler?

Tags:    c++

<< < 12 > >>
Det er ikke sådan at der er nogle derude der ved hvor man kan opstøve sådan en gratis, helst med IDE og til Windows?

(Gosh jeg lyder som en noob... IDE og Windows :D)



@HSP:

Personligt synes jeg at Win32 API'et er noget outdated skidt, og vil stadig råde dig over i et andet framework! Win32 er LANGT fra minimalt! Og sjovt nok heller ikke cross-platform, og jeg kan udlede af din indledende post at du også bruger Linux/OSX. Lær da hellere et cross-platform framework at kende, så du med den samme eller nok mindre arbejdsindsats kan producere langt bedre kode, og et bedre produkt.

EDIT:
Hvis du alligevel bestemmer dig for Win32 API, så kan jeg huske, at da jeg rodede med det, lavede jeg nogle "wrapper" classes for at gøre koden enklere og smukkere. Gem evt. noget af al den gentagende syntax i klasser. (Groft sagt)



Indlæg senest redigeret d. 28.09.2010 23:26 af Bruger #11328
@HSP:

Personligt synes jeg at Win32 API'et er noget outdated skidt, og vil stadig råde dig over i et andet framework! Win32 er LANGT fra minimalt! Og sjovt nok heller ikke cross-platform, og jeg kan udlede af din indledende post at du også bruger Linux/OSX. Lær da hellere et cross-platform framework at kende, så du med den samme eller nok mindre arbejdsindsats kan producere langt bedre kode, og et bedre produkt.

EDIT:
Hvis du alligevel bestemmer dig for Win32 API, så kan jeg huske, at da jeg rodede med det, lavede jeg nogle "wrapper" classes for at gøre koden enklere og smukkere. Gem evt. noget af al den gentagende syntax i klasser. (Groft sagt)


Hmm ja okay...

Hvad vil i så anbefale. Har kigget på et par, men er langt fra en c++ ørn ( i hvert fald på UI området) og nok heller ikke helt i resten af sproget.... Jeg er udmærket godt klar over hvad jeg vil kaste mig ud i nu, men tro mig folkens jeg lærer virkelig bedst af at være derude hvor jeg ikke kan bunde længere (det der det sjove er) :P

Anyway, har kigget på nogle frameworks jo, men hvis jeg vil lave cross platform (og ja antagelsen var korrekt, Linux Mint og noget Ubuntu er velkendte medlemmer her i familien) hvad skulle jeg så vælge? Og hvor er der en rigtig god guide, helst med nogle færdige eksempler som minimum på "hello world" så jeg ikke skal bekymre mig så meget om det basiske i første omgang





GTK+ - Tutorial
Qt - Tutorial

Lige du to jeg har stiftet nærmere bekendtskab med. Jeg heller personligt mest til GTK+, men det er jo smag og behag.. :)



Til cross platform vil jeg anbefale enten wxWidgets:
http://www.wxwidgets.org/
Eller QT:
http://qt.nokia.com/products/

Jeg har brugt wxWidgets lidt, det er helt ok. Der er en del der siger at QT er bedre, og i dag står nokia bag QT, så den bør du også tage et kik på.

Uanset hvad, GUI udvikling er aldrig enkelt, slet ikke hvis det skal være cross-platform.



Til cross platform vil jeg anbefale enten wxWidgets:
http://www.wxwidgets.org/
Eller QT:
http://qt.nokia.com/products/

Jeg har brugt wxWidgets lidt, det er helt ok. Der er en del der siger at QT er bedre, og i dag står nokia bag QT, så den bør du også tage et kik på.

Uanset hvad, GUI udvikling er aldrig enkelt, slet ikke hvis det skal være cross-platform.



Nej jeg havde også på fornemmelsen at alle skrev c++ hvis det var... Føler mig bare lidt "tumpet" hvis i ved hvad jeg mener, ved at placere ****** på .NET og så bare sige "Når ja, det er let..." og om 20 år så sidde "Microsoft og deres licenser!!"





Jeg vil foreslå QTCreator
http://qt.nokia.com/products/developer-tools?currentflipperobject=821c7594d32e33932297b1e065a976b8

Hvis du kører linux kan den installeres fra din pakkehåndtering og til Windows kan du hente den fra QTs hjemmeside.

Den virker til at være meget Delphi/VisualStudio med C# agtig.
Indtil videre har jeg kun leget med GUI-delen da mit projekt indtil videre ikke har noget GUI af betydning.
Jeg bruger den som IDE, compiler, debugger og selvom jeg kun lige er begyndt at bruge den på Linux hvor jeg tidligere brugete KDevelop så er jeg meget imponeret indtil videre.

-Martin




Jeg vil foreslå QTCreator
http://qt.nokia.com/products/developer-tools?currentflipperobject=821c7594d32e33932297b1e065a976b8

Hvis du kører linux kan den installeres fra din pakkehåndtering og til Windows kan du hente den fra QTs hjemmeside.

Den virker til at være meget Delphi/VisualStudio med C# agtig.
Indtil videre har jeg kun leget med GUI-delen da mit projekt indtil videre ikke har noget GUI af betydning.
Jeg bruger den som IDE, compiler, debugger og selvom jeg kun lige er begyndt at bruge den på Linux hvor jeg tidligere brugete KDevelop så er jeg meget imponeret indtil videre.

-Martin




Hej Henrik

Din hjememsider virker ikke :-(



Hej Henrik

Din hjememsider virker ikke :-(



Tak tak :)
Jeg kigger lidt på det, selvom jeg har haft lidt travlt med skolen, så har ikke haft så meget C++ indlærings tid :'(

Og yeah, I know... Fik smidt en anden fil oven i min index, og så har jeg bare været for doven til at fikse det, da jeg alligevel ikke har noget seriøst på siden lige pt.

Kan være jeg ligger en blog eller noget op, en dag hvor jeg får tid :pirat:



Indlæg senest redigeret d. 05.11.2010 14:13 af Bruger #14381
<< < 12 > >>
t